See what you can do with getUserMedia
To complement MDN's monthly Dev Derby, Mozillians Toronto is hosting monthly workshops where local hackers can come out, see a presentation on the monthly topic, and then hack together in Mozilla Toronto's community space!
No experience necessary as our presenters and our community will be on hand to help you out, however we can't guarantee how much 1:1 help will be available. Don't worry though, submissions for the contest are open til the end of the month so you'll have lots of time to finish your demo.
